Lesson Plan (grade 11 – advanced)
Period :48 Preparation date : 24/11/2011
Unit : 6 Lesson : writing (cont)
I. Aims :
- By the end of the lesson, the students are able to describe trends in
graphs
- By the end of the lesson, the students are able to write a description
of the information illustrated in graphs
II. Lexical items :
- projected
- fluctuate
III. Structures :
- the graphs shows the number of overseas students studying at Yale
university …
- The population is expected to remain unchanged for the first decade.
IV. Teaching aids:
- textbook - handouts - Sheets of paper
- chalk and board
V. Techniques :
- writing-based
